Riyad Bank celebrated the graduation of 100 ladies from the training courses of Nabtah program in its 3rd edition. The program was adopted by AlBir Society and sponsored by Riyad Bank, part of its social development initiatives aimed at enabling the society members to acquire professional skills that qualify them to enter the job market and become productive elements in society.
